### Ticket: Signature verification failure after hermetic build migration

During the migration of the Ferncastle build to the new hermetic system (Brickforge), the verification stage began rejecting artifacts with a digest mismatch. Root cause: the sealed builders embed a normalized timestamp, so artifacts signed under the legacy pipeline no longer reproduce. Old signatures are therefore invalid by design, not compromise. All Brickforge outputs must be re-signed; the replacement deploy key follows.

deploy key for fawif-kahif: bky3_Xc9

Hello plugin authors,

Next Thursday, Corbexa will run a disaster-recovery drill for the RestockRoute vending-machine restock planner. During the failover window, plugin callbacks will be replayed against the standby scheduler, so please ensure your handlers are idempotent and tolerate duplicate route assignments. No customer restock data will be altered. To re-register your plugin against the standby environment during the drill, authenticate with the recovery passphrase provided below.

vault phrase of hahip-tajeg = quenax-briath-briax

Handover — fd leak hunt on Grelling ingest

Torv, picking up where I left off: the Grelling ingest workers are leaking file descriptors, roughly 40/hour per pod. I've ruled out the metrics exporter and the S3-style uploader; lsof shows the leaked fds are pipes from the transcode subprocesses. Suspect we skip cleanup when a child exits nonzero. Repro: feed a corrupt sample through staging and watch the count climb. Restart threshold is set low as a stopgap. The staging config I tested against is as follows.

settings of fafog-haduf:
ZORIX_PIN=4648
ZORIX_METRICS_HOST=metrics.zorix.paliqsys.corp
ZORIX_LOG_LEVEL=info
ZORIX_TENANT=druix

Facilities ticket — Halewick Tower, night shift.

Issue: support team reporting east stairwell reader rejecting badges after midnight. Reader was reset this morning; firmware updated. Overnight crew should now badge as normal. If the reader fails again, use the manual keypad by the fire door — do not prop the door. Log any further failures with the time and badge name. Temporary keypad code for the fallback door is below.

door code, tajeg-fawip: bdg-K-62